Situated where the Leie & Schelde rivers join, the vibrant city of Ghent is full of charm, history, culture, gastronomy, eclectic art galleries & inviting cafes that spill onto cobbled medieval squares. The city’s gothic architecture was once home to proud merchants & powerful kings & is still one of the wealthiest medieval cities in the historic Flanders region. Brussels & Bruges often overshadow Ghent, but it is truly Belgiums best-kept secret, according to Lonely Planet.
